如何处理软件崩溃问题:软件频繁崩溃的原因是什么?

时间:2025-12-15 分类:电脑软件

现代社会中,软件应用已融入我们生活的方方面面。频繁的程序崩溃问题却给用户带来了极大的困扰。一旦软件崩溃,不仅会影响工作效率,甚至可能导致重要数据的丢失。理解软件崩溃的原因与相应的处理方法,对于提高软件的稳定性和用户体验显得尤为重要。本文将对软件崩溃的常见原因进行深入分析,并提供切实可行的解决方案,帮助用户应对这一困扰。

如何处理软件崩溃问题:软件频繁崩溃的原因是什么?

软件崩溃的原因通常可以归结为几个主要方面。首先是程序代码本身的缺陷。在开发过程中,程序员可能会因为疏忽而留下bug,这些缺陷在特定情况下触发时,就会导致程序的崩溃。由于软件与操作系统之间的兼容性问题,某些软件在不同版本的操作系统上会出现不稳定,这同样是崩溃的原因之一。用户的系统环境,包括硬件配置和其他同时运行的软件,也可能间接导致软件崩溃。

另一个常见的问题是资源管理不当。许多软件在使用过程中可能会出现内存泄漏或资源占用过高的情况。当资源消耗达到一定程度时,程序将无法继续运行,最终导致崩溃。定期监测和管理程序所需资源是每位程序开发者和用户应当重视的环节。

针对软件崩溃问题,用户可以采取一些简单有效的措施。定期更新软件版本,以确保使用最新的修复补丁和功能增强。用户应配合系统更新,这样不仅能提高软件的兼容性,也能提升系统的整体性能。备份重要数据也是预防数据丢失的有效措施,定期进行数据备份可以在遇到问题时及时恢复。

软件崩溃是一个复杂且多因素的问题。通过深入分析崩溃原因并采取相应措施,可以在一定程度上降低崩溃发生的频率,提高软件的稳定性。无论是开发者还是用户,理解和关注这一问题,才能在日常使用中获得更加顺畅的体验。